=== July–September === * [[July 6]]– The [[Transylvanian peasant revolt]] comes to an end with a formal treaty signed at the monastery of Cluj-Manastur, reducing the [[tithe]] to be paid to their employers, and abolishing the tax requiring surrendering one-ninth of each individual's production of wine and grain, and confirming the right of peasants to move freely within Transylvania.<ref>Pal Engel, ''The Realm of St Stephen: A History of Medieval Hungary, 895-1526'' (I. B. Tauris, 2001) {{ISBN|9780857731739}}</ref> * [[August 22]]– Portugal's disastrous Tangier expedition to attack Morocco begins as [[Prince Henry the Navigator]] and more than 6,000 troops (3,000 knights, 2,000 infantry, 1,000 archers) sail from the port of [[Belém, Lisbon|Belém]] toward Africa and the Portuguese colony of [[Ceuta]]. They arrive at Ceuta five days later.<ref name=Quintella>Ignacio da Costa Quintella, ''Annaes da Marinha Portugueza'', 2 vols (Lisbon: Academia Real das Sciencias, 1840) pp.87-95</ref> * [[September 20]]– **Led by [[Prince Henry the Navigator]], a poorly-prepared Portuguese [[Battle of Tangier (1437)|attempt to conquer]] the city of [[Tangier]] in the [[Marinid dynasty|Marinid Sultanate]] in [[Morocco]] begins. Although the Portuguese have more than 6,000 troops, they reach the walled city and find that their scaling ladders are too short to reach the top, and their artillery is too weak to damage the walls.<ref name=Quintella/> **The siege of the [[Sion Castle]] in [[Bohemia]] by the armies of the [[Sigismund of Luxembourg|Emperor Zikmund Lucemburský]] is successful. * [[September 30]]– A Moroccan relief force of at least 10,000 cavalry and 90,000 foot soldiers arrives at Tangier to halt Portugal's assault on Tangier.<ref name=Quintella/>
